In March 1948, the Allies decided to combine the various occupied territories of Germany into one economic entity. The Soviet representative resigned from the Allied Control Council in protest.

Consistent with the introduction of the new Deutsche Mark in West Berlin (as well as throughout West Germany), which the Soviets viewed as a violation of their agreements with the Allies, Soviet occupying forces in East Germany began blocking all railroads, roads and waterways. Did communication between Berlin and the West.

On June 24, the Soviet Union announced that her four-power regime in Berlin had ended and that the Allies no longer had rights there. On June 26th, the US and UK began airlifting food and other essentials into the city. They also organized similar “airlifts” in the opposite direction of West Berlin’s greatly reduced industrial exports. By mid-July, the Soviet occupation forces in East Germany had grown to his 40 divisions, and the Allies to his 8 divisions.

By the end of July, his three groups of US strategic bombers had been sent to Britain as reinforcements. Tension remained high, but war didn’t stop
